Police and a bomb squad are investigating a “suspicious item” near the University of Oklahoma campus.

What happened?

The school’s emergency alert system notified students of a “law enforcement emergency” in the area of Oak Tree Avenue and 12 Avenue SE around 1:30 PM.

According to Sarah Jensen, the Norman Police Department public information officer, a suspicious item was found at an apartment complex in the area.

For the time being, a bomb squad has been called to investigate, so local residents and students are told to avoid the area.

UPDATE: Around 3:15 PM, officials announced that the issue had been resolved. The Norman Transcript gave the following message:

“OUPD sent out an alert at about 3:15 p.m. reporting the law enforcement emergency at near Oak Tree Ave and 12th Ave SE has been resolved.”
